Oracle Database Administrator
Hirextra
Phoenix, AZ (In Person)
Full-Time
Skill Insights
Compare your current skills to what this opportunity needs—we'll show you what you already have and what could strengthen your application.
Job Description
Role :
Oracle Database Administrator Location:
Phoenix AZ Duration:
Long term- Experience as DBA.
- Install, configure, monitor, and maintain MySQL and MemSQL (SingleStore) database servers in on-premises and cloud environments.
- Perform routine MySQL server patching, version upgrades, and security hardening.
- Conduct MemSQL/SingleStore version upgrades, including planning, testing, and rollback procedures.
- Manage user access, roles, permissions, and security policies across all database platforms.
- Monitor database performance, identify bottlenecks, and implement query and index optimizations.
- Ensure high availability and disaster recovery through replication, failover, and backup/restore strategies.
- Administer and manage Google Cloud Platform Cloud SQL instances (MySQL and PostgreSQL), including provisioning, scaling, maintenance windows, and failover configurations.
- Manage Cloud Spanner instances including schema design, performance tuning, and monitoring.
- Administer BigQuery datasets, tables, access controls, partitioning strategies, and cost optimization.
- Implement and manage Cloud SQL read replicas, automated backups, and point-in-time recovery.
- Configure and manage IAM roles and VPC networking for secure database access in Google Cloud Platform.
- Plan, design, and execute database migrations from on-premises to Google Cloud Platform, including MySQL to Cloud SQL, and legacy systems to BigQuery or Spanner.
- Use tools such as Database Migration Service (DMS), mysqldump, Datastream, or custom ETL pipelines for seamless migrations.
- Perform pre-migration assessments, schema conversions, data validation, and post-migration performance tuning.
- Coordinate with application and DevOps teams to minimize downtime during cutovers.
- Develop and maintain Python scripts for database automation tasks such as health checks, backup verification, alerting, data exports, and report generation.
- Automate repetitive DBA tasks including user provisioning, schema deployments, and performance reporting.
- Set up and manage monitoring using Google Cloud Platform Cloud Monitoring or equivalent tools for all database platforms.
- Respond to and resolve database-related incidents, alerts, and on-call escalations in a timely manner.
- Maintain runbooks and documentation for all operational procedures. Preferred Qualifications
- Google Cloud Professional Data Engineer or Cloud Database certification
- Experience with Terraform for IaC-based database provisioning
- Exposure to SingleStore (MemSQL) distributed architecture and workload management
Similar remote jobs
Anywhere Real Estate
San Antonio, TX
Posted2 days ago
Updated20 hours ago
Farmers Insurance Careers
Posted2 days ago
Updated20 hours ago
Infodyne Solutions
Thousand Oaks, CA
Posted2 days ago
Updated20 hours ago
Similar jobs in Phoenix, AZ
Jack in the Box Stine Enterprises - 5814 S Central Ave, Phoenix, AZ
Phoenix, AZ
Posted2 days ago
Updated20 hours ago
Similar jobs in Arizona
JT MedStaff
Glendale, AZ
Posted2 days ago
Updated20 hours ago
TCI Agencies
Scottsdale, AZ
Posted2 days ago
Updated20 hours ago
Accountable Healthcare Staffing
Sun City West, AZ
Posted2 days ago
Updated20 hours ago
Titan Medical Group
Show Low, AZ
Posted2 days ago
Updated20 hours ago